I disagree
If you can threshold brake properly you can brake as effectively as as with an ABS equipped car
The purpose of ABS is to prevent lockup under heavy braking, so that you don't skid / able to steer.........same can be accomplished with threshold braking
I can only speak for my car, in which case the issue is brakes that are inherently inefficient as compared to more modern cars......10' solid rotors and small brake pads with lining developed thirty years ago....and drums in the back with under-rated wheel cylinders.
